Transaction 26aeabff4fd96832710ceb838f7067aa95fa0968fb3d297ffcf361e58162c832

1 Input
2 Outputs
  • 26aeabff4fd96832710ceb838f7067aa95fa0968fb3d297ffcf361e58162c832:0
  • value  171291030
    address  3FiVpBwSPCQvNiwndHh8eT1ehga1SEPbeQ
  • 26aeabff4fd96832710ceb838f7067aa95fa0968fb3d297ffcf361e58162c832:1
  • value  9485187510
    address  3JTZQ7ZS6fsBfej7bgmrJvCmLHPRMCmjC2